Hotel Description

Pension Sonnenschein, located at In d. Riemeske 13, 57392 Schmallenberg, Germany, is a charming, pet-friendly hotel nestled in the scenic beauty of the Sauerland region. Surrounded by lush green landscapes and rolling hills, this tranquil hotel offers guests a peaceful retreat while being conveniently close to local attractions and activities. Its welcoming ambiance and rustic decor create a cozy atmosphere, making it an ideal destination for those seeking a relaxing getaway in nature. The hotel's convenient location makes it easy to access a variety of nearby sights, including the Naturpark Sauerland Rothaargebirge (11 min by car), the breathtaking Kahler Asten mountain (25 min by car), and the renowned Bikepark Winterberg (19 min by car), offering ample opportunities for outdoor adventures such as hiking, biking, and skiing. The rooms at Pension Sonnenschein are designed with comfort in mind, offering a serene escape with warm furnishings and plenty of space to unwind. Though the hotel doesn't feature a fitness center or spa, guests can enjoy a variety of other amenities such as free Wi-Fi, parking, and pet-friendly accommodations. For dining, guests can explore nearby restaurants like the fine dining Gourmetrestaurant Hofstube Deimann (5 min by taxi) and Landgasthof Schneider in Westfeld (6 min by taxi). Additionally, Bambina mia, a pizza restaurant, is just 2 minutes away by taxi. Pension Sonnenschein is conveniently located with excellent public transport options nearby, including Paderborn Lippstadt Airport, just over an hour away by taxi. 5/5
Very good little guesthouse. Rooms are clean and adequately equipped. Only the bathroom was a bit small. The room was pleasantly cool despite summer temperatures (25-30°C). Ms. Blank is very nice and can give you lots of tips about the area. Oberkirchen is generally a very good starting point for hikes in the area and for exploring the Hochsauerland. It is also ideal to stay overnight here with a dog. What should be highlighted is the good breakfast with a lot of homemade food, there was something different every day. I stayed here for 10 nights in late summer with my dog ​​and really enjoyed my time here.
